About the Property

Award-Winning Restaurant and Spacious Rooms
Nestled in a 10-acre private estate, Dryburgh Abbey Hotel offers a luxurious stay with an award-winning restaurant and large rooms featuring upscale toiletries. Enjoy the convenience of free Wi-Fi and on-site parking, with historic Dryburgh Abbey just a stone's throw away.

Scenic River Views and Elegant Dining Options
Individually designed rooms at Dryburgh boast en suite bathrooms and picturesque views of the River Tweed. Guests can savor delectable meals at either the Abbey Bistro or Tweed Restaurant, choosing from a delightful à la carte menu.

Exclusive River Access and Cozy Lounges
Experience the charm of private fishing rights and unwind in 2 guest lounges adorned with crackling open fires. The Victorian hotel's riverside location offers a serene retreat, with easy access to St Boswells and the stunning Northumberland National Park.

Property Notes

Please inform Dryburgh Abbey Hotel in advance of the ages of any children staying. You can use the Special Requests box when booking, or contact the property directly with the contact details provided in your confirmation. Bookings of more than seven rooms require a £50 per room non refundable deposit to secure. This is payable within 48 hours of the original booking being made. If payment is not made within this timeline, the reservation will be canceled. A deposit may be required at the property.
